Green & May are delighted to offer to the market this traditional home being situated within the centre of this sought after village. The accommodation has the benefit of a gas central heating system and has double glazing where specified and we strongly recommend viewing this deceptively spacious unusual property as soon as possible. Briefly the accommodation comprises: Entrance hall with stairs rising to the first floor accommodation, lounge and fitted kitchen. To the first floor there are three double bedrooms with ornamental feature fireplaces and two with built in wardrobes. The fourth bedroom would make an ideal study/hobby room. There is a bathroom and a separate WC. To the outside there is a courtyard and parking for two vehicles.
Within the village of Swanwick there is a local store/post office, butchers, chemist, medical centre, places of worship and a range of schooling. Swanwick is well placed for access to the surrounding centres of Nottingham, Derby, Mansfield and Chesterfield.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on September 21,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on September 21,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
